Weatherstripping
Weather stripping is often omitted however it can have a major impact on your energy consumption and keep out cold drafts.
There are several kinds of weather stripping So be sure to choose the right one for your requirements. For instance, metal weatherstripping will last longer than felt, which is less expensive and simpler to install. Foam tape or gaskets are another popular option for DIYers at home however they're not as effective as an old-fashioned rubber seal.
Before you start installing new weather stripping, be sure to clean off the frame of your door or window with a damp cloth and repair any rough areas. This will give the new stripping a smooth surface to stick to and will make the seal more efficient. It's also always best to replace all of the weather stripping at once rather than just some small areas.
Felt weather stripping is sold in rolls, either plain or reinforced with a pliable metal strip. It's easy to cut using scissors and can be glued or stapled into place around doors and windows. It's not the most durable, however, and only lasts a year or two.
You can find vinyl or tubular rubber in a majority of hardware stores. It can be installed on doors and windows. It's not as durable as other types of weather stripping. However, it's still a good option for homes with a lot of.
There are also interlocking weather strips made of metal at numerous building supply stores. It's a bit more difficult to install, but it offers the best seal. It is recommended that professionals install this kind of weather stripping. You'll need to measure the perimeters of your doors and windows and add 5-10% for waste prior to installing the weather stripping. This will ensure you have enough weather stripping to complete the job right. Follow the directions on the package and you'll be set! It's a low-cost and easy method to increase your home's efficiency.
Paint
uPVC (unplasticised polyvinyl chloride) frames for windows and doors can become discoloured over time and a paint finish can give your home a new look without having to replace the entire frame. A high-quality UPVC paint and a fresh coat of gloss can make all the difference in transforming your window or door.
When painting UPVC it's important to select a paint that can bond to the surface and shield it from UV damage. It's also recommended to light sand the area in order to provide a better "key" for the paint to stick and will make cleaning up much simpler afterward. This is particularly crucial for UPVC windows and doors that face south, as they'll be exposed to a lot of heat.
The UPVC paint should be applied with a brush or foam roller and it's best to apply a few thin coats, allowing each to dry between. It's a good idea to apply a roller to larger areas and a brush for smaller spaces or corners that are difficult to reach. The final coat needs to dry and cure according to the manufacturer's instructions, and it's a good idea to wait at minimum a couple of weeks prior to using the doors or windows again.
It's a great way to update the appearance of your home, without the need to replace it. Many people paint the frames of their uPVC doors and windows to give them a brand new appearance.
